The values of a, for which the points $$A, B, C$$ with position vectors $$2\widehat i - \widehat j + \widehat k,\,\,\widehat i - 3\widehat j - 5\widehat k$$ and $$a\widehat i - 3\widehat j + \widehat k$$ respectively are the vertices of a right angled triangle with $$C = {\pi \over 2}$$ are :
$$2$$ and $$1$$
$$-2$$ and $$-1$$
$$-2$$ and $$1$$
$$2$$ and $$-1$$
Explanation
$$\overrightarrow {CA} = \left( {2 - a} \right)\widehat i + 2\widehat j;$$
$$\overrightarrow {CB} = \left( {1 - a} \right)\widehat i - 6\widehat k$$
$$\overrightarrow {CA} .\overrightarrow {CB} = 0$$
$$\,\,\,\,\,\,\,\, \Rightarrow \left( {2 - a} \right)\left( {1 - a} \right) = 0$$
$$ \Rightarrow a = 2,1$$
